The Commission for Evangelisation and Formation (CEF) was created in January 2007 and was officially launched in May 2007. The commission and has a wide and developing remit.
In the synagogue at Nazareth Jesus says "The Lord has sent me to evangelise the poor." (Luke 4:18)
Pope Paul VI, in his great encyclical "Evangelisation in the Modern World" (Evangelii Nuntiandi), described Christ as the greatest evangeliser.
Pope Paul also teaches that evangelisation is the special grace and vocation of the Church.
"Our Vision is to help every member of our Diocese to appreciate more deeply their role as an evangeliser and to enable them to carry out that calling." — Commission for Evangelisation and Formation
